3 under noise

Started by mscampbell75, September 08, 2008, 03:06:00 PM

Previous topic - Next topic

0 Members and 1 Guest are viewing this topic.

mscampbell75

I tried to go from split to 3 under.  My group tightned up nicely.  It feels pretty comfortable.  BUT, I have gained alot of noise that I didnt have before.

Any thoughts!

What do you have for silencers? Did you move your nocking point? I find I need to set my nock point slightly higher for 3 under. Shooting a heaiver arrow will also help.

i shot 3under for a long time and there is more noise with this style. I believe its got to do with the tiller of the bow even if its tillered for 3 under. I switched to split this past winter because of the noise. However 3under works very well for a lot of folks including myself, but in time I'm glad I switched you can quite your bow with as mentioned or try limb savers they work very well. When you go to 3 under you need to retune your bow you will have to bring your nock point up some most of my bows are 5/8"-3/4" nock hight also play with the brace hight change it a 1/8" at a time and find the sweet spot the sweet spot in the brace hight may be a bit differnt on your bow 3 under also move your silencers up and down your string untill you find the sweet spot with them when it is all done 3 under will not be loud but you do have to retune your bow.
